You’ve never seen historic charm quite like this! Denver’s famous Capitol Hill is a thriving urban neighborhood featuring stately mansions and a bohemian vibe. With local boutiques, trendy bars, and cozy coffee shops, Capitol Hill has everything and more to keep one entertained without having to leave town. Popular attractions like the Colorado State Capitol building and City O’ City, a hip vegetarian eatery, are at your fingertips in Capitol Hill!
Located within a mile of Downtown Denver, residents of this neighborhood love living near local attractions such as the Denver Art Museum and Civic Center Park. Unique architecture and historic homes define this charming neighborhood. Modern apartments, condos, and townhomes, as well as mid-century apartment complexes and homes dating back to the early 1900s, line Capitol Hill’s residential streets.

My apartment was filthy when I moved in. The walls are scratched and dirty, with hooks still hanging from the previous tenant. The shower didn't work, the bathroom sink doesn't drain well. My windows don't open. Half of the outlets don't work. Mice have been a problem for the entire building. It's sweltering in Denver, and my air conditioning blows hot air. The main office is slow to respond and prefers band-aids to actual solutions. They threatened to evict me, in the middle of the pandemic, because I was a day late on paying rent. It was an honest mistake - I didn't realize rent was due on the 3rd, not the 5th. No email, no message, just a letter from their lawyer taped to my door. Parking is a nightmare. The back alley door is often broken and unlocked, packages are routinely stolen; I have mine delivered to my girlfriend's apartment. It's cheap by Denver standards, but by any objective measure, you'll overpay for this place.
This was my first apartment when moving to Denver. I quickly regretted my decision to move into this complex. The building is very old with tons of plumbing and heat issues. My tub was clogged majority of my time living in the unit with little support from maintenance. The old radiator heater would ONLY heat on high... in winter months my apartment was a sauna with heater on and frigid without it on. Windows poorly insulated and old, so I could hear everything from the street. Kitchen is very small with no dishwasher and a tiny sink. Loud noises constantly from neighbors due to poorly insulated walls and floors/ceilings. Street parking is awful in Capitol Hill and would drive around for 30-45min looking for a spot sometimes 6-10 blocks from apartment complex. Overall, very poor experience. Look elsewhere.

Applicant has the right to provide the property manager or owner with a Portable Tenant Screening Report (PTSR) that is not more than 30 days old, as defined in § 38-12-902(2.5), Colorado Revised Statutes; and 2) if Applicant provides the property manager or owner with a PTSR, the property manager or owner is prohibited from: a) charging Applicant a rental application fee; or b) charging Applicant a fee for the property manager or owner to access or use the PTSR.
